



The Francis is a cognac double monk strap — warmth and confidence in the same shoe. Two buckles, no laces, a clean closed throat, in a reddish tan that catches the light and keeps it. The upper is top-grade European calfskin, the cognac built up by hand: burnished deeper at the toe and heel so it glows between amber and copper as the light shifts. It's built on the 675 last — an almond toe with a slightly deeper fit, a rounder and more classic read than the sharp 722, and the comfortable choice for long days on the foot. Made by our artisans in a workshop in Almansa, Goodyear welted one pair at a time. A full leather sole keeps it dressy.
